Our local convicts will be sentenced and sent to the cells at Shire Hall Historic Courthouse Museum in Dorchester on 19th April 2024! Will they be able to raise the bail and get out of jail?

Weldmar Hospicecare needs to raise £26,000 a day to continue the specialist end of life care we provide in Dorset, both in the comfort of patient's own homes and at our IPU in Dorchester. 20% of our costs are met by the NHS, the rest comes from the generosity of our local community.

The Accused: Sarah Pavey - Weldmar Hospicecare

The Crime: Not making enough cups of tea for the staff

The plea: I promise I will make more

The evidence:

It’s certainly not a case of ‘Teasmade’ when Sarah’s in the office. She has tried all sorts of tactics to avoid making a brew, including turning off the water supply, hiding the teabags and claiming exemption of duty on religious grounds.

Will she be able to convince the Judge in under 2 minutes that she is not guilty?
